Autostereoscopic 3D projection display based on two lenticular sheets
Authors:Lin Qi  Qionghua Wang  Jiangyong Luo  Aihong Wang  and Dong Liang
Institution:1 School of Electronics and Information Engineering, Sichuan University, Chengdu 610065, China 2 State Key Laboratory of Fundamental Science on Synthetic Vision, Sichuan University, Chengdu 610065, China
Abstract:We propose an autostereoscopic three-dimensional (3D) projection display. The display consists of four projectors, a projection screen, and two lenticular sheets. The operation principle and calculation equations are described in detail and the parallax images are corrected by means of homography. A 50-inch autostereoscopic 3D projection display prototype is developed. The normalized luminance distributions of viewing zones from the simulation and the measurement are given. Results agree well with the designed values. The proposed prototype presents full-resolution 3D images similar to the conventional prototype based on two parallax barriers. Moreover, the proposed prototype shows considerably higher brightness and efficiency of light utilization.
